What they do

A Landscape Architect plans and designs outside spaces and land, including parks, private gardens, subdivisions, highways, and industrial sites. Uses architectural and design skills and knowledge of plants and trees; addresses land use issues; reviews the environmental impacts of construction projects.

What You'll Do:
Dream up and design one-of-a-kind outdoor spaces that feel personal and intentional Collaborate directly with residential and commercial clients—from concept to completion Use design software like Visterra (or similar) to bring visions to life Integrate plants, pavers, pergolas, lighting, water features, and more into cohesive outdoor environments Conduct site visits and lead the design phase with a focus on both beauty and function Coordinate with vendors, installers, and subs to ensure what's on paper becomes real—flawlessly Stay ahead of trends in outdoor living, sustainable design, and Florida-friendly landscaping
What You Bring:
A creative soul with an eye for detail and a love for natural beauty Proven experience in landscape design—residential, commercial, or both Comfort with design software and a strong understanding of plant palettes and hardscape materials Excellent communication and client relationship skills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ple projects with poise Bonus points if you have knowledge of local codes, HOA guidelines, or experience managing installs Bachelor's degree in Landscape Architecture, Landscape Design, Horticulture, or a related field is preferred Licensure or certification in landscape architecture is a plus, but not required Why Troy's Tropics?
